Don Sweeney provided insight on Torey Krug, the NHL season, and more

Bruins general manager Don Sweeney is hopeful.

Sweeney told reporters on Friday that he’s hopeful he can get a deal done with Torey Krug to get him to stay in Boston for the future. He also said he’s hopeful that the NHL season will resume.

In addition to sharing the things he hopes will happen, Sweeney addressed the future of Zdeno Chara, who will be a free agent whenever the season ends, and Kevan Miller, who has missed the entire season due to knee injuries he suffered last season.
